Why These Are the Top Insulation Contractors in LB

The insulation market in Long Beach is competitive and service-rich, driven by the city's mild but variable climate and a high awareness of energy efficiency among homeowners. The average quality of contractors is high, with several providers holding advanced certifications from organizations like BPI and being approved installers for various state and utility rebate programs. Competition is strong, which generally benefits consumers through competitive pricing and a focus on customer service. Typical pricing varies significantly by project scope and material. Basic blown-in fiberglass attic insulation can start from $1.50-$3.00 per square foot, while more complex spray foam projects can range from $3.50 to $7.50+ per board foot. Many homeowners leverage energy audits to qualify for rebates that can cover a substantial portion of the cost for air sealing and insulation upgrades, making high-performance services more accessible.

Frequently Asked Questions About Insulation in LB

Get answers to common questions about insulation services in LB, California.

1What is the typical cost to insulate an attic in Long Beach, and are there any local rebates or incentives?

For a standard 1,500 sq ft home in Long Beach, attic insulation costs typically range from $1,500 to $3,500, depending on material choice (like blown-in cellulose or fiberglass batts) and existing conditions. Homeowners should check for rebates from the Long Beach Water & Power (LBWP) Home Energy Savings Program and statewide incentives like those from the California Tax Credit for Solar Energy, which can include insulation. These programs can significantly offset the upfront cost while lowering monthly energy bills in our mild but heating/cooling-dependent climate.

2When is the best time of year to install or upgrade insulation in Long Beach?

The ideal time is during our mild fall (September-November) or spring (March-May) seasons, avoiding the summer heat that can make attic work unbearable and the occasional winter rains. Scheduling during these shoulder seasons ensures contractor availability and allows you to prepare your home for both the mild, damp winter and the hot, dry summer, maximizing comfort and efficiency year-round.

3Are there specific insulation materials or R-value recommendations for Long Beach's coastal climate?

Yes, due to Long Beach's mild but variable coastal climate (cool damp winters and warm dry summers), the California Title 24 energy code recommends specific R-values, typically R-30 to R-60 for attics. Materials like blown-in cellulose or fiberglass are common, but for homes in more humid coastal zones, spray foam can provide an excellent air and moisture barrier. A local professional can perform a Title 24 compliance assessment to determine the optimal material and R-value for your specific home.

4How do I choose a reputable insulation contractor in Long Beach?

Always verify the contractor holds a valid California Contractors State License Board (CSLB) license, specifically in the "C-2" (Insulation and Acoustical) classification. Look for local companies with strong reviews on platforms like Yelp or Google My Business, and ask for proof of liability insurance and local references in neighborhoods like Belmont Shore or Bixby Knolls. Reputable contractors will also provide a detailed written estimate and discuss compliance with Long Beach building codes and Title 24.

5My older Long Beach home feels drafty. Will adding insulation alone solve my comfort issues?

While adding insulation is crucial, in many of Long Beach's historic bungalows and mid-century homes, air sealing is equally important. Gaps around windows, doors, attic hatches, and plumbing penetrations allow Pacific breezes and moisture to enter, undermining insulation performance. A comprehensive energy audit, often available through LBWP, can identify these leaks. The most effective approach is a combination of air sealing and adding insulation to the recommended R-value for our climate zone.
